The admission process for the BTech Chemical Engg. course can easily take around 3 to 5 months to complete because each college abides by its individual guidelines for giving admission that include entrance exams, college application forms, result release, cutoff lists, college counseling, seat allotment, and fee payment.
For merit-based admissions to BTech Chemical Engineering, you may also have to give the GD or PI rounds for final selection. So, it is always good to check the official college websites for their admission guidelines to be on the safer side.

It is not compulsory to give an entrance exam for getting admission to the BTech Chemical Engineering course. There are more than 80 colleges in India that admit students on the basis of Class 12 merit and usually take extra rounds like the PI or GD.
Having said that, it is always better to give the entrance test and score good marks in the same to keep both the options available with you. Top colleges like the IITs and NITs in India strictly consider the entrance test marks for giving admission to the course. Rest, the choice is completely yours.

Almost all of the top colleges offering the BTech Chemical Engineering course release the application forms in the online mode, where you have to fill out all the details correctly, submit the scanned copies of the important documents, and pay the application fee, which is around INR 500 to INR 3,000, based on the college to which you apply. The registration window is open for a limited time period, so make sure you apply before it gets closed to avoid any last-minute hassle.

Yes, IISER Bhopal accepts JEE score for admission. You can get admission in IISER Bhopal through JEE Main rank if you fulfill the eligibility criteria for the JEE advanced channel, which is to secure a JEE Advanced rank within 10,000. You also need to have 10+2 with a Science stream and Maths as one of the subjects. IISER Bhopal offers a BS-MS degree programme for four years. You can also apply for admission through KVPY and SCB channel.

The B.Tech placements at Indore Institute of Science and Technology (IIST) are generally considered good, with placement rates typically exceeding 80% for most programs.
Strengths:
- High Placement Rates: As mentioned, most B.Tech programs at IIST achieve placement rates above 80%, with some branches like CSE exceeding 90%. This indicates strong industry connections and employability potential for graduates.
- Reputed Companies: IIST attracts several renowned companies for campus placements, including IT giants like Infosys, TCS, Wipro, Cognizant, and Accenture, along with core engineering firms like Bosch, Tata Motors, and Mahindra & Mahindra.
- Average Salary Packages: While salary packages can vary depending on the company and branch, the average package for B.Tech graduates at IIST typically ranges between 4.5 LPA and 5.5 LPA, which is considered decent for fresh graduates in Indore.
- Career Support Services: The institute provides career guidance and placement assistance to students through workshops, mock interviews, resume writing sessions, and industry interaction events.
Potential Drawbacks:
- Competition for Top Companies: Popular branches like CSE and ECE might see intense competition for placements with top companies, requiring strong academic performance and technical skills to stand out.
- Limited Diversity in Job Profiles: Although several companies visit the campus, placement opportunities might be concentrated in the IT sector, with fewer options in specific core engineering domains.
- Salary Packages Compared to Top Colleges: While the average salary packages are satisfactory, they might not be as high as those offered by premier engineering colleges across India.
The B.Tech placements at IIST are positive, offering decent job opportunities for graduates. However, it's essential to consider individual programme statistics, competition levels, and desired career paths to make a well-informed decision. Remember, placement success also depends on individual efforts, academic performance, and skill development beyond academics.
